As we are in the month of October today we are counting down our favorite scary characters in television, movies, and books. Before that we go all in on Luke Cage. Dan reviews the new Cage comic and we give our general thoughts on the Luke Cage series. (More to come next week) Greg also gives a review of the biggest show of the summer Stranger Things.
